Sans Normal Abloy 4 is a regular weight, normal width, low contrast, italic, normal x-height font.

A slanted sans with smooth, rounded bowls and largely monolinear strokes. Curves are drawn with even pressure and generous counters, while straight stems and diagonals keep a crisp, engineered rhythm. Uppercase forms are simple and open (notably C, G, S), and the lowercase maintains a steady x-height with compact ascenders and descenders. Numerals follow the same rounded construction, with clear, open shapes and consistent stroke endings.
Well suited to interface typography, dashboards, and product UI where an italic voice is needed for hierarchy or emphasis while remaining readable. It can also work for editorial subheads, presentations, and corporate or tech branding that benefits from a modern slanted sans tone.
The overall tone is contemporary and straightforward, with an unobtrusive, practical feel. Its italic angle adds a sense of motion and emphasis without becoming expressive or calligraphic, keeping the personality calm and professional.
Likely intended as a versatile italic sans for everyday communication—providing emphasis and forward momentum while preserving the neutrality and legibility expected of a general-purpose text and display companion.
The design favors clarity through open apertures and broad internal spaces, helping letters stay distinct at text sizes. Terminals appear clean and slightly softened rather than sharply cut, which keeps the texture smooth in paragraphs.
